Strategy:

This is a very aggressive deck and are looking to close out games ASAP. On average you should win between turns 6-8.  The first 1-5 turns is about board control. Sometimes it is best not to attack with your stealth minions right away and instead wait to use them to trade up into your opponents 2 or 3 cost minions. 

Always prioritize minion damage/development over spells/weapons. Your stealth minions generally are weak and have low health so the sooner you can get them on the board and doing chip damage/trading the better. 

Skydiving Instructor is actually pretty cool in this deck. Not only does it pull out your stealth minions to synergize with your other cards but it thins your deck. Thinning your deck is important because instead of top-decking that Worgen Infiltrator when you're looking for lethal you topdeck Eviscerate, thus making the deck more consistent in its job.

 

 

Mulligan:

Always Keep: Blazing Battlemage, Spymistress, Worgen Infiltrator, Skyvateer, Akama, Greyheart Sage

Sometimes Keep: Backstab (Vs. DH/Hunter/Rogue), Ashtongue Slayer (going first and have a turn 1 stealth), Edwin VanCleef (going second), Skydiving Instructor (going second and you have a turn 1 minion)
